Solution for -0.1x+2.1y=-9.7 equation:


Simplifying
-0.1x + 2.1y = -9.7

Solving
-0.1x + 2.1y = -9.7

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-2.1y' to each side of the equation.
-0.1x + 2.1y + -2.1y = -9.7 + -2.1y

Combine like terms: 2.1y + -2.1y = 0.0
-0.1x + 0.0 = -9.7 + -2.1y
-0.1x = -9.7 + -2.1y

Divide each side by '-0.1'.
x = 97 + 21y

Simplifying
x = 97 + 21y
